Paxtang
Village
Photo: Mr. Matté,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Paxtang is a borough in Dauphin County, Pennsylvania, United States. As of the 2020 census it had a population of 1,640. The borough is a suburb of Harrisburg and is one of the earliest colonial settlements in South Central Pennsylvania.
East Harrisburg
Suburb
Photo: Penndyl, CC BY-SA 4.0.
East Harrisburg is a district of neighborhoods in the eastern end of Harrisburg, Pennsylvania. Its southern border is formed by Interstate 83; eastern border is Paxtang along 29th Street; northern border is Market Street and the borough of Penbrook; western border is the Allison Hill neighborhood along 21st Street and including Bellevue Park.
